Poor Stance While Utilizing Tools



If you find yourself experiencing neck pain frequently, one usual perpetrator could be your position while utilizing devices. When you stoop over your phone or laptop for extensive periods, you placed strain on your neck muscular tissues and spine. Your head, which evaluates concerning 10 to 12 pounds, ends up being much heavier as you lean onward, bring about added pressure on your neck. This inadequate stance can lead to stiffness, discomfort, and even lasting concerns like muscular tissue discrepancies and misalignments.

To stop neck pain from tool use, make a mindful initiative to keep good position. Maintain your gadgets at eye level to avoid flexing your neck downward. Take breaks every half an hour to extend and move.

Sit in a chair with correct back support and avoid slouching. Additionally, take into consideration ergonomic accessories like laptop stands or adjustable desks to improve your stance while dealing with devices. By focusing on your posture, you can reduce the stress on your neck and prevent pain in the future.

Lugging Heavy Bags Erratically



When it comes to daily habits that can contribute to neck pain, another element to consider is how you bring heavy bags. Carrying a heavy bag erratically, whether it's a backpack, handbag, or briefcase, can lead to strain on your neck and shoulders. When you regularly carry a heavy bag on one side of your body, it causes an inequality in your posture, leading to muscular tissue stress and prospective imbalance of the back. This unequal distribution of weight places included anxiety on one side of your body, creating your neck muscle mass to function tougher to compensate for the discrepancy.

To avoid neck discomfort from bring heavy bags erratically, try to distribute the weight uniformly by utilizing a knapsack with two shoulder straps or changing sides frequently if you're using a single-shoulder bag. Take into consideration decluttering your bag to lower unnecessary weight, and go with bags with broader, cushioned bands for far better weight circulation. Being mindful of just how you lug your bags can aid prevent unnecessary strain on your neck and shoulders.
